Paper Abstract
This paper reviews recent best basis search algorithms. The problem under consideration is to select a representation from a dictionary which minimizes an additive cost function for a given signal. We describe a new framework of multitree dictionaries, and an efficient algorithm for finding the best representation in a multitree dictionary. We illustrate the algorithm through image compression examples.
